Pullovers are a classic bodybuilding exercise that targets the chest, back, and shoulder muscles. The exercise involves lying on a bench with a dumbbell or barbell and extending the weight over the head, before bringing it back down behind the head and lowering it towards the chest. This movement provides a deep stretch to the chest muscles and works the lats, triceps, and shoulders as well. Pullovers can be done with a variety of equipment, including dumbbells, barbells, cables, and machines. They are a great exercise for building upper body strength, size, and definition. They are also useful for improving flexibility and range of motion in the shoulder joints. Pullovers can be done as a standalone exercise or as part of a chest or back workout. They are suitable for both beginners and advanced lifters, but proper form is important to avoid injury and maximize results.
